Cullercoats Brewery Wilde North Blonde

Wilde North Blonde

 

Cullercoats Brewery in North Shields, Tyne & Wear, England 🏴󠁧󠁢󠁥󠁮󠁧󠁿

  Golden / Blonde Ale Regular
Score
6.47
ABV: 3.8% IBU: - Ticks: 6
Brewed with fresh wet hops from Wilde Farm Northumberland within 24 hours of picking - surely the most Northern hops in England. Bramling Cross and Fuggle.

Bottle from CentrAle, Newcastle. Pours light hazy yellow gold with a thin white head. Aromas of straw, floral hops, faint lemon. Taste is grassy bitter, creamy malt. Thin finish.

Clearish gold with a decent white head. Nice orange notes. Bitter, herbal and a nice citrus note. Quite well balanced.
